Transaction 85276aae064bc0ef011b41f856947f37c33a4836000def99df734e198e103573

1 Input
2 Outputs
  • 85276aae064bc0ef011b41f856947f37c33a4836000def99df734e198e103573:0
  • value  201749
    address  39CDKW1TeGm3or6ojmJnxuSYKE4UhDDYzC
  • 85276aae064bc0ef011b41f856947f37c33a4836000def99df734e198e103573:1
  • value  1579309
    address  3C63qx6UyCSji9GDTPFu3JFTSnLKtZo91r